I seemed to recall that most of the payments to the Crown goes on paying for the upkeep of the Royal Palaces (in particular Buckingham Palace and Windsor Castle) and the staff employed there. It should also be noted that Buckingham Palace and Windsor Castle are owned by the State and not by the Royal family - so in effect the State is maintaining its own properties.
